USB 2.0 interface cable

# The USB model comes with High Speed USB2.0 cable, which is

capable of burning or copying DVD or CD at the maximum
speed of the drive.


# Since USB 2.0 Hi-Speed is an evolution of the existing USB 1.1

specification, it is fully forward and backward compatible with
current USB systems.

# If your computer’s USB controller is only USB1.1 you can only

achieve a 4X maximum CD writing speed.

# If you do not have a USB2.0 port, you may install an optional

USB2.0 adapter or controller (see optional accessories section
on page 13) to your computer to achieve the maximum DVD and
CD writing speed.



USB interface cable installation

Attach the USB 2.0 interface cable to the computer connector (C2, figure
1 on Page 6) at the back of the DVD DigiCopier firm and securely – you
should not be able to disconnect the cable without pressing the release
notch.
